From 44d74b5bd8f072188c814474db94d4bdd6d36f3e Mon Sep 17 00:00:00 2001 From: lisyarus Date: Mon, 23 May 2022 20:49:37 +0300 Subject: [PATCH] Fix ui::label wrapping --- libs/ui/source/label.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/libs/ui/source/label.cpp b/libs/ui/source/label.cpp index 2137106a..b9f7ada4 100644 --- a/libs/ui/source/label.cpp +++ b/libs/ui/source/label.cpp @@ -476,7 +476,7 @@ namespace psemek::ui if (wrap_end && current_item > line_begin) { std::size_t space_pos = current_item - 1; - while (space_pos > line_begin && (!items[current_item].character || !std::isspace(*items[space_pos].character))) + while (space_pos > line_begin && (!items[space_pos].character || !std::isspace(*items[space_pos].character))) --space_pos; if (space_pos > line_begin)